How it works

Every rule, in plain language.

No black box. If you can't explain a tool, you shouldn't trust it near your account — so here's exactly what this one does.

01

Real-time equity monitoring

No fixed timeframe — it watches your account tick by tick, not just on candle close. The moment you're near a limit, it knows.

02

Independent daily & max loss limits

Set your daily and max drawdown limits separately, matching your prop firm's actual rules — not a single generic threshold.

03

One-click prop-firm presets

FTMO, FundedNext and The5ers rule sets built in — or build a fully custom profile for any firm's specific limits.

04

Trailing drawdown & profit lock

Supports trailing max-loss calculations for firms that require it, and can raise your floor as you bank profit so a good day can't fully unwind.

05

Two-stage panic close

One click arms it, a second confirms — closes everything instantly when you need it, but a stray click can't nuke a healthy account.

Honest fit

Who this is for — and who it isn't.

Built for you if

  • You're trading a funded or challenge account and want a hard technical backstop, not just willpower
  • You want your daily/max usage visible at a glance, not calculated in your head mid-session
  • You run multiple prop accounts and want consistent, rule-based protection across all of them
  • You'd rather a tool block you than explain a blown account after the fact

Skip it if

  • You want something that also places trades — this protects, it doesn't enter
  • You're trading a personal account with no external drawdown rules to enforce
  • You already have equivalent protection built into your own EA
  • You plan to raise your own limits the moment they feel restrictive
